Getting There

  • Car

    From the town of Gbarnga in Eastern Region, head southwest on the main road (Liberia Route 1) towards Monrovia. Continue on this road for approximately 64 kilometers until you reach the junction at Kakata. At the junction, take a left onto Liberia Route 7 towards Buchanan. After about 54 kilometers, you will reach the coastal town of Buchanan. From Buchanan, follow the signs to Lake Piso, which is about 20 kilometers northwest of the town. The drive will take you through beautiful rural landscapes, and you may want to stop for refreshments in Buchanan.

  • Public Transportation

    From Gbarnga, find a local taxi or shared vehicle heading towards Monrovia. The fare for this trip is usually around 200-300 Liberian Dollars (LRD). Upon reaching Monrovia, you will need to take another vehicle towards Buchanan. The fare for this stretch is approximately 500 LRD. Once in Buchanan, you can hire a motorcycle taxi (okada) to take you to Lake Piso, which should cost around 200-300 LRD. Be sure to negotiate the fare in advance.

  • Motorcycle Taxi

    If you are in Buchanan, you can hire a motorcycle taxi to take you directly to Lake Piso. This is a quick and efficient way to reach the lake, taking about 30 minutes. Negotiate the fare before starting your journey; expect to pay around 200-300 LRD for the trip.

Discover more about Lake Piso

Nestled in the heart of Liberia, Lake Piso is an enchanting freshwater lake that captivates visitors with its breathtaking scenery and serene atmosphere. Surrounded by lush greenery and vibrant wildlife, this hidden gem is perfect for those looking to escape the hustle and bustle of city life. The lake spans a considerable area, offering various opportunities for exploration and adventure, from hiking along its scenic shores to enjoying tranquil boat rides on its crystal-clear waters. It is not just a place for relaxation; it is a sanctuary where you can immerse yourself in nature's beauty. The diverse ecosystems around the lake provide a habitat for numerous bird species, making it a paradise for birdwatchers and photographers alike. As you stroll along the banks, you might encounter local fishermen casting their nets or families enjoying picnics under the shade of towering trees. The vibrant colors of the flora and fauna create a picturesque backdrop that changes with the seasons, ensuring that each visit feels unique. Whether you are seeking solitude or a place to connect with friends and family, Lake Piso promises a rejuvenating experience.
